Tuna Cheese Melts

A lovely open faced sandwich to have with soup.

2 (6oz cans) Chunky Tuna, well drained
1/2 cup finely chopped Celery
2 finely chopped Dill Pickles
1/2 cup Mayonnaise
1 teaspoon Celery Salt
Coarse pepper, to taste
6 slices Cheddar Cheese
*6 Slices Whole Grain Bread, lightly toasted
6 Tomato Slices
Green Onions, greens only, thinly sliced

Line baking tray with parchment paper.
Place whole grain bread on lined baking tray, place in oven and turn oven on to heat to 350F
While oven is heating, prepare filling:
In medium mixing bowl combine drained tuna, chopped celery and dill pickles, mayo, celery salt and pepper.
Remove baking tray from oven, spread tuna mixture on bread slices; top each with a tomato and cheddar slice.
Return to oven and bake for 15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ted.
Cut each slice diagonally, place 2 pieces on each plate and sprinkle with thinly sliced green onions
